例
ときのJavaScriptを実行し<menu>要素がコンテキストメニューとして表示されます。
<div contextmenu="mymenu">
<p>Right-click inside this box to see
the context menu!
<menu type="context" id="mymenu"
onshow="myFunction()">
<menuitem label="Refresh"
onclick="window.location.reload();"></menuitem>
</menu>
</div>
»それを自分で試してみてください 定義と使用法
場合onshowイベントが発生し<menu>要素がコンテキストメニューとして示されています。
ブラウザのサポート
表中の数字は完全にイベントをサポートする最初のブラウザのバージョンを指定します。
イベント | |||||
---|---|---|---|---|---|
onshow | サポートされていません | サポートされていません | 8.0 | サポートされていません | サポートされていません |
構文
HTMLには:
JavaScriptで:
object .onshow=function(){ »それを自分で試してみてください
JavaScriptでは、使用してaddEventListener()メソッドを:
object .addEventListener("show", myScript );
»それを自分で試してみてください 注: addEventListener()メソッドは、Internet Explorer 8およびそれ以前のバージョンでサポートされていません。
技術的な詳細
バブル: | ノー |
---|---|
取消し可能: | ノー |
イベントの種類: | イベント |
サポートされているHTMLタグ: | <メニュー> |
DOMバージョン: | レベル3のイベント |
関連ページ
HTMLリファレンス: HTMLのContextMenu属性
HTMLリファレンス: HTML <menu>タグ
<イベントオブジェクト